UserSplit Cutover Drift: the extracted account service and the legacy Marigold monolith user module are reporting divergent record counts during dual-write. This fires when drift exceeds 0.5% over 15 minutes. New team members should not replay writes manually. Reconciliation steps and the rollback procedure are documented on the internal page.

wiki page, tajog-fafog: https://gitlab.paliqsys.corp/dash/display/job/853dd6fcbf54

Handover — Vexler partner SFTP drop

Ownership moves to you today. Drop runs hourly from Vexler's end into the intake bucket via the relay host. Watch for zero-byte files; their exporter flakes on Mondays. Creds live in the ops vault, path noted in the runbook. Vault auto-seals after 48h idle. Support escalations go to the on-call rotation, not me. If the vault is sealed when you need it, unseal with the recovery passphrase below.

recovery phrase for tadug-fafof: zorwyn-kasion

Memo to Sales Leads — Thornbury Office. Quick heads-up: we're closing the Thornbury satellite at quarter-end. It never hit the volume we hoped for, and the lease renewal numbers don't help. The three account staff there move to remote coverage under Priya's team, so no client handoffs should be visible externally. Keep messaging light until the official note goes out — "consolidating regional coverage" is the line. What we're actually planning for that territory is outlined below.

confidential, kagep-kahof: Druokax Systems plans to lower the Ulaath list price by 53 percent in March.